Ingredients

To make a delicious Cinnamon Roll Casserole, gather these simple ingredients:

– 2 cans (12.4 oz each) refrigerated cinnamon rolls

– 4 large eggs

– 1 cup whole milk

–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

– 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on

– 1/2 cup brown sugar

– 1/2 cup chopped pecans or walnuts (optional)

– 1/4 cup raisins (optional)

– Cream cheese frosting from cinnamon rolls (for drizzling)

– Powdered sugar (for dusting)

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ation Steps

1. Preheat the oven and prepare the baking dish

Start by setting your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grab a 9×13-inch baking dish and grease it with non-stick spray or butter. This will help the casserole not stick.

2. Cut cinnamon rolls and arrange in the dish

Open the cans of cinnamon rolls. Use a sharp knife to cut each roll into quarters. Place these pieces evenly in the greased dish. Make sure they are spread out well.

3. Mix egg mixture 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together 4 eggs, 1 cup of whole milk, 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ract, 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on, and 1/2 cup of brown sugar. Mix until everything is well combined.

4. Pour the egg mixture over cinnamon rolls

Carefully pour the egg mixture over the cinnamon roll pieces. Use a spatula to gently press the pieces down. This helps every piece soak up the yummy mixture.

Baking Instructions

1. Cover and bake for the initial time

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il. Place it in the preheated oven and bake for 25 minutes. This keeps the moisture in while it cooks.

2. Remove foil and complete baking

After 25 minutes, carefully remove the foil. Let it bake for an additional 15 to 20 minutes. The casserole should puff up and turn golden brown. Check with a toothpick. It should come out clean when done.

3. Cool slightly and add toppings for serving

Once baked, take the casserole out of the oven. Let it cool for about 10 minutes. Drizzle the cream cheese frosting from the cinnamon rolls over the top. If you want, dust it with powdered sugar for a sweet finish.

Dietary Modifications

If you have dietary needs, don’t worry! You can make gluten-free or dairy-free versions of this casserole. For a gluten-free option, use gluten-free cinnamon rolls. Many brands offer these in stores. Check the labels to ensure they’re safe for your diet.

For a dairy-free version, swap whole milk with almond milk or oat milk. You can also use a dairy-free cream cheese for the frosting. These small swaps keep the dish tasty while meeting your dietary needs.

Storage Info

How to Store Leftovers

To store your Cinnamon Roll Casserole, let it cool first. Then,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il. Place it in the fridge. It will stay fresh for about 3 to 4 days. When ready to eat, you can reheat individual pieces in the microwave. Heat for about 30 seconds, then check if it’s warm enough. If not, heat for an extra 15 seconds. For best flavor, enjoy it warm.

Freezing Guidance

If you want to freeze your casserole, cut it into portions first. Wrap each piece in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er bag. Make sure to squeeze out as much air as possible. This helps prevent freezer burn. You can freeze it for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to eat, take it out of the freezer and let it thaw in the fridge overnight.

To reheat, place the thawed piece in a microwave-safe dish. Heat for about 1 to 2 minutes, checking every 30 seconds. You can also reheat it in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es. FAQs

Can I make this casserole 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the casserole the night before. Just follow the steps up to pouring the egg mixture over the cinnamon rolls. Cover it and place it in the fridge. In the morning, bake it straight from the fridge. You might need to add a few extra minutes to the baking time.

What can I use instead of the cream cheese frosting?

If you want a different topping, consider using maple syrup or a simple glaze made with powdered sugar and milk. You can also top it with whipped cream for a lighter option. Each choice adds a unique flavor twist.
